Application Development: Design, develop, and maintain web applications using .NET Core, LINQ, and Entity Framework 6 (EF6).
API Development: Build and consume RESTful APIs, ensuring performance, scalability, and security.
Database Management: Work with relational databases, write efficient queries using LINQ and Entity Framework, and optimize database operations.
Code Optimization: Refactor and optimize code to improve performance and maintainability.
Troubleshooting & Debugging: Identify issues and bugs and provide efficient solutions in a timely manner.
Collaboration: Work closely with business analysts, testers, and other developers to deliver high-quality software solutions.
Unit Testing: Write unit tests to ensure high code coverage and the reliability of applications.
Documentation: Maintain clear and concise documentation for software architecture, code, and deployment processes.
Code Review: Participate in code reviews and ensure that best practices and coding standards are followed.
Skills:
Experience: Minimum of 5 years of hands-on experience in .NET Core development.
Strong experience with .NET Core (MVC, Web API, etc.)
LINQ for querying and manipulating data efficiently.
Experience with Entity Framework 6 (EF6) for data access and ORM.
Knowledge of SQL Server or other relational databases and advanced query writing.
Web Development: Experience with HTML, CSS, JavaScript, and modern front-end technologies.
Version Control: Familiarity with Git or other version control systems.
Software Architecture: Understanding of software architecture principles such as MVC, RESTful design, and microservices.
Agile Methodology: Familiarity with Agile development methodologies and working in sprints.
Problem Solving: Strong analytical skills with the ability to troubleshoot and solve complex problems.
Job Type: Full-time
Application Question(s):
Are you comfortable for 1 Year contract?
Are you comfortable for Saudi time zone and weekends?
Experience:
Dotnet Core: 5 years (Required)
LINQ: 4 years (Required)
Entity Framework: 4 years (Required)
Work Location: Remote
Beware of fraud agents! do not pay money to get a job
MNCJobsIndia.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.